Learner Driver Insurance: Complete Guide for UK Learners

DriveThruL Driving School19 February 20267 min read
Car insurance documents and keys

Key Takeaways

  • Learner driver insurance lets you practise in any car with a supervising driver
  • You can get cover from just a few hours up to annual policies
  • Claims do not affect the car owner no-claims bonus
  • You must have a valid provisional licence and the car must have MOT and tax
  • A fully qualified driver (3+ years licence) must supervise you
  • Compare quotes as prices vary significantly between providers

Learning to drive with a professional instructor is essential, but getting extra practice in a family car can help you pass faster. Learner driver insurance makes this possible without affecting the car owner's policy.

1 What is Learner Driver Insurance?

Learner driver insurance is a separate policy that covers you to practise driving in someone else's car. This means:

  • ✓ No effect on the owner's policy - If you have an accident, it goes on YOUR policy, not theirs
  • ✓ Protect their no-claims bonus - The car owner keeps their discount safe
  • ✓ Build your own record - Some policies let you earn your own no-claims bonus as a learner
  • ✓ Flexible durations - Get covered for hours, days, weeks, or months

3 Requirements for Learner Insurance

Before You Can Get Covered

  • • You must hold a valid UK provisional driving licence
  • • The car must have valid MOT and road tax
  • • A fully qualified driver (held full licence for 3+ years) must supervise
  • • L plates must be displayed on the front and back of the car
  • • You cannot drive on motorways (provisional licence restriction)

4 How Much Does It Cost?

Learner driver insurance costs vary based on your age, location, and the car you want to drive. Here are typical prices:

Duration Typical Cost
2 hoursFrom £8
1 dayFrom £15
1 weekFrom £30
1 monthFrom £80
AnnualFrom £500

Prices are approximate and depend on your personal circumstances. Always compare quotes.

5 Tips for Getting the Best Deal

  • 1 Compare multiple providers - Prices can vary significantly
  • 2 Consider the car's insurance group - Lower groups are cheaper to insure
  • 3 Check for cashback offers - Some providers offer deals for new customers
  • 4 Build your no-claims - Some policies let you build NCB as a learner
